Transaction 7471005a3492e8ae3d5cf06f6cd7660dbad252e27f915bac637cf53b5addb0d0

5 Input
2 Outputs
  • 7471005a3492e8ae3d5cf06f6cd7660dbad252e27f915bac637cf53b5addb0d0:0
  • value  134000000
    address  3B5pPTNtJfYJ8u75qrCsYwxp7F5hd6xVm8
  • 7471005a3492e8ae3d5cf06f6cd7660dbad252e27f915bac637cf53b5addb0d0:1
  • value  77018205
    address  32WTNppAEoUZfSPdjeHBLAqC39aFskzPVc